Product Cost
Cost of product is not included in course tuition. Additional material costs include $620 per vial of Botulinum Toxin, $317-$677 per box of dermal filler, and/or $10 – $50 per solid filler PDO thread. Prices are dependent on brand requested and are subject to change at any time. Products bought at the course are for use at the course only. Attendees may bring their own products but must show proof that they are original and authentic. A list of other necessary supplies will be provided for you to bring to the live patient course.
